The Public Safety Committee met on April 3, 2018, at 4:30 p.m. in the council chambers at City Hall.

Present: Chairman Hughes, Alderman Sharp, Alderman Braun, Mayor White,

Fire Chief Benisch, Police Chief Mettille, Office Manager Passage, City Clerk Hurd

Absent: None

Alderman Hughes called the meeting to order.

Special Event Request – Illinois River Valley Ride Sales:

Clerk Hurd presented a request submitted by William Ware for use of City Park and Cutright Park on May 19, 2018. Connie Ware was in the audience and presented information to the committee in regards to the event. Ms. Ware explained to the committee that some of the crafters will be set up at Shore Acres Park. Ms. Ware stated that Discussion was held. Alderman Hughes questioned the vendor fees. Ms. Ware stated that vendors at shore acres are separate and that the overflow of vendors would go to the city park and any fees would go to the city. It was the consensus of the committee and Ms. Ware that there was not a need for the use of both parks. The consensus of the committee was to seek council approval for the use of City Park for the Illinois River Valley Sales Rid and Craft Show subject to the City Clerk receiving proof of Insurance.

Special Event Request – Vfw Cruise In:

Clerk Hurd presented a request submitted by Tom Harms of VFW Post #4999 for the use of Santa Fe Ave from Mathews to Wilmot on June 23, 2018 form 11:00am to 8:00pm for their annual cruise in. Discussion was held. It was the consensus of the committee to seek council approval for the event.

Special Event Request – Tri 2 Beat MS:

Clerk Hurd presented a request submitted by Leann Stickel for the use of Second Street from Shore Acres Park entrance to Walnut St. for the annual Tri 2 Beat MS event to be held on June 9, 2018. It was the consensus of the committee to seek council approval for use of Second Street for the event subject to the City Clerk receiving proof of Insurance.

Special Event Request – Ivc Band Boosters 5k Ghost Chase:

Clerk Hurd presented a request submitted by Tara Morr of the IVC Band Boosters for the use of Second Street from Cedar Street to Sunset Terrace and North Half of Boat Launch Parking Lot on October 27, 2018. It was the consensus of the committee to seek council approval for the event.

Special Event Request – Run For The Health Of It – Pearce Community Center:

Clerk Hurd presented a request submitted by Raquel Herron for the annual Run for the use of various city streets on June 30, 2018. Discussion was held. It was the consensus of the committee to seek council approval for the event.

Ordinance – Open Container:

Mayor White presented an ordinance to carry open container alcohol at a special event on public property. Mayor White explained the ordinance. Chief Mettille had no problems with the written ordinance. Discussion was held on how the fee would be established based on how many officers were needed for the event.

Generator – Police Department:

Chief Mettille reported that he has informed the ETSB to remove the generator at the police station that is owned by the ETSB. Chief Mettille told the committee that the city has a spare generator (originally in the police dept.) that will be re-installed at the police station.

Dispatcher Consolidation:

Chief Mettille gave an update on negotiations with Bartonville and the City of Peoria. He told the committee that he will give an update at the next committee meeting.

Police Update:

Chief Mettille present reports on impound vehicle and ordinance violations. (Report attached)

Travel Policy – Fire Department:

Fire Chief Benisch presented an updated Travel, Convention, and Seminars & Workshop Policy for the Fire Department. Discussion was held. It was the consensus of the committee to seek council approval for the updated policy.

Purchase No-Mex Hoods, Name Tags, Wipes & Solution – Fire Department:

Fire Chief Benisch requested approval to purchase of 25 hanging name patches as follows:

Cost of Patches $874.00 from Dinges Fire Company,

Installation of Patches $375.00 from Blankenship Upholstery

It was the consensus of the committee to seek council approval for the purchase.

Chief Benisch also requested permission to purchase Nomex Hoods at a total of $573.75 and Toxoff Surfa at a cost of $460.00. The consensus of the committee was to have the Mayor sign a purchase order for the nomex hoods and toxoff.

CHIEF Benisch requested an advance for himself and one firefighter to attend the 2018 FDIC Conference.

Fire Department Update:

March run report: 89 calls/ YTD 277 calls

Fire Chief Benisch reported that Engine #1 is out of service due to air compressor failure.

Fire Chief Benisch reported that one defensive firefighter is in place, Jerry Myers. There will be an introduction meeting on April 21 for possibly four others that have filled out application.

He reported that all new turn out gear has been issued.

Property Maintenance:

Chief Mettille to the committee that he will have a report at next meeting.

Chairman Hughes reported that he had a complaint about Dana Bannister burning behind his building on Second Street.

Chairman Hughes stated that he had complaint about a property on Walnut Street that had previously been turned in.

Old Business:

Amendment – Zoning Fees:

Mayor White reported that the construction committee has met and will have revisions to some fees.

Emergency Prepredness Plan:

No Action

There being no further business the meeting adjourned at 5:45 p.m.
